"I´ll be OK" is a series of pictures on my interpretation of the thoughts and feelings of victims of sexual abuse.

The amount of reported rapes in Oslo has increased with a shocking 84 % the last ten years. In just the last year the reported assault rapes have more than doubled.

After interviewing two women who have been sexually abused, I photographed my interpretation of their feelings and thoughts. It´s about the shame, guilt and isolation many feel, and about moving on and taking back control over their own lives and bodies.
